Manchester United midfielder Paul Pogba facing weeks on the sidelines after hamstring injury against Basle

* Manchester United are sweating over the fitness of Paul Pogba after leg injury
* Pogba went off in the Champions League clash against Basle holding hamstring
* France midfielder hobbled off after just 19 minutes after overstretching in tackle
* Pogba's replacement Marouane Fellaini broke the deadlock with a firm header


Paul Pogba faces the prospect of weeks on the sidelines after a hamstring injury ended his night as Manchester United captain abruptly.

The central midfielder pulled up after just 19 minutes against Basle at Old Trafford, appearing to overstretch while making a challenge, and he left the ground on crutches.

Pogba immediately signalled to the bench and headed straight down the tunnel shaking his head in disappointment.

His replacement, Marouane Fellaini, headed home United's opener soon after being introduced.

It is the second hamstring problem 24-year-old Pogba has suffered in six months. He also departed early against Rostov during the Europa League knockout clash in March.


Manchester United midfielder Paul Pogba was forced off the pitch with a hamstring injury. The typical length of time out with a hamstring injury is three weeks, which Pogba now faces

Pogba returned from that strain earlier than expected, back after three weeks, but it remains to be seen how severe this latest issue is.

Speaking on BT Sport shortly after Pogba was taken off, Steven Gerrard said: 'It certainly looks like a hamstring.

'Me and Frank [Lampard] were talking off-camera and when you get a moment like that it'll be at least three weeks [out injured]. You get a bit of tightness in your hamstring and you're usually back within a week but worrying for United fans this could be as this could be a three-weeker or maybe more.'

Meanwhile, Lampard added: 'It's the sort of injury you don't mind getting early in the season but if you're going to get them he got one at the important stage last year.

'But at this stage they've got a strong squad and Fellaini's come in and done well there. It might take three or four weeks but eventually he'll be back and firing.'

Jose Mourinho's side are in the midst of a hectic schedule, with five games to play in the next 17 days before October's international break.

The run includes Premier League matches against Wayne Rooney's Everton, Southampton and Crystal Palace, plus a Champions League trip to CSKA Moscow.

Mourinho had planned to rest Pogba for the League Cup game with Burton Albion next Wednesday but this injury could leave Mourinho short on creativity in midfield, with Fellaini, club captain Michael Carrick and Ander Herrera — absent from the squad altogether last night — the options to deputise alongside Nemanja Matic.

Manchester United midfielder Paul Pogba has private scan behind closed doors after hamstring injury suffered in Champions League opener

* Manchester United beat Basle 3-0 in their Champions League opener
* Paul Pogba was forced off injured after 19 minutes and later left on crutches
* United conducted a scan on the Frenchman at their Carrington training ground
* The injury is likely to rule the 24-year-old out of United's October fixtures
* Team-mate Marcus Rashford has said United have enough depth to manage


Paul Pogba underwent a scan on his hamstring injury behind closed doors at Manchester United's training ground on Wednesday.

United invested millions in state-of-the-art medical equipment at their Carrington base to assess stars rather than utilising nearby hospitals.

Pogba headed straight for the tunnel after pulling up just 19 minutes into Tuesday's Champions League victory over Basle and later left Old Trafford on crutches.


Paul Pogba has had a scan on his injured hamstring behind closed doors at Carrington and has posted a photograph on his Instagram, saying: 'When you know all will be fine'

It is his second hamstring problem in six months and Jose Mourinho fears he could miss a cluster of matches before October's international break.

United face Everton, Southampton and Crystal Palace in the Premier League, plus a trip to CSKA Moscow in Europe.

Mourinho faces an anxious wait to see the extent of the setback, with their first game back after the internationals being at Liverpool just a month away.

'Paul's going to be a massive miss and hopefully we can get him back fit as soon as possible,' Marcus Rashford said.

'That's why you have such a strong squad. It's good for the manager, it's good for the players as well because we're always playing for competition.'


Pogba's Champions League opening game was cut short as Manchester United beat Basle 3-0. The 24-year-old - and captain on the night - limped off at old Trafford after just 19 minutes. He has since had a scan behind closed doors at United's Carrington training ground

Pogba's absence could open the door for Ander Herrera, who was not included in the squad against Basle.

Herrera, crowned Player of the Year last season, was not injured and finds himself behind Marouane Fellaini in the midfield pecking order.

Mourinho confirmed Pogba is definitely ruled out of the return of Wayne Rooney on Sunday, while Jesse Lingard claimed Romelu Lukaku can emulate their former captain.

Asked if the Belgian, who already has six goals for United, can become an icon, Lingard said: 'Yeah, I think Rom's a very nice lad, he's got his feet on the ground, he doesn't let anything faze him.

'As long as he keeps scoring the goals he is going to make the headlines. He holds the ball up well but he also runs in behind defences.

'He's very strong in the box he is very good with his head, so he gives a lot of options for the man on the ball.'

INJURY UPDATE ON POGBA, SHAW AND ROJO

Jose Mourinho has confirmed Manchester United midfielder Paul Pogba will miss Sunday’s Premier League game against Everton with the hamstring injury he sustained in midweek.

The France international was named as captain for the UEFA Champions League match against FC Basel, but was substituted in the first half with a muscular problem. He was replaced by Marouane Fellaini and the Belgian showed his worth, scoring the opening goal and assisting Marcus Rashford later on.

Speaking to MUTV during an interview at the Aon Training Complex, Jose began by providing an update on Pogba's fitness. “He is injured and he cannot play on Sunday,” the manager told us.

The boss revealed he does not yet know how long Pogba will be out for and later added: "We know that, for a few matches, I don't know how many, but I expect we are to play without Pogba for a few matches." However, Jose he was keen to stress his absence is a fantastic chance for the rest of the squad to impress.

“That is an opportunity for others and the others are ready to get that opportunity, and to perform," he stated. "Of course we feel sorry that we lose a player but we are calm and confident, because it is an opportunity for people who are ready to take it.”

Mourinho also provided an update on the fitness of Luke Shaw, who is yet to play for the senior side this season but has been training hard in recent weeks. "He is not injured anymore so it is a question of form and it is a question of options. But he is not injured, he is recovered."

On the subject of Marcos Rojo, another long-term absentee, the boss said: "He is still in the timings of such an important injury. Everything went really well, but he's not even training with the group in normal sessions, he's just doing parts of it. So Marcos still has in front of him, probably, a couple of months."

Paul Pogba being out for three months is 'completely nonsense' says Jose Mourinho as Manchester United star awaits tests on hamstring injury

* Jose Mourinho still to discover how long injured Paul Pogba will be out for
* Manchester United boss blasts suggestion Pogba will miss three months
* Says it is 'completely nonsense' the former Juventus man will be out for 12 weeks
* Old Trafford boss Mourinho says Pogba's hamstring injury still being assessed


Manchester United manager Jose Mourinho dismissed the suggestion that Paul Pogba faces 12 weeks out as 'completely nonsense' as his hamstring injury is still being assessed.

The 24-year-old led United out as captain for the first time on Tuesday night, but only lasted 19 minutes of the Champions League opener against Basle due to a hamstring complaint.

Pogba left Old Trafford on crutches and has undergone scans, but Mourinho insists no definitive prognosis has been made on the influential midfielder's absence amid talk of a three-month lay-off.


Jose Mourinho has slammed speculation Pogba will be miss three months of this season. Mourinho said it is 'completely nonsense' Pogba is set to miss 12 weeks with a hamstring injury

'I don't know if it is 12 weeks or 12 days,' the United boss said after Sunday's 4-0 defeat of Everton.

'Honestly, so any comment, any rumour is totally wrong, because we do not know if it is 12 weeks or 12 days.

'The player was diagnosed initially after the match because of the conditions of the muscle and the bleeding.

'The decision was one more week to wait and to see really clearly in the scans the dimension of the injury.

'And nobody in the club spoke about 12 days or 12 weeks. Not at all.

'It's a muscular injury in the hamstring, but we have a normal procedure and wait a few more days, so it's completely nonsense information.'

Manchester United poised to make decision on whether Paul Pogba needs surgery on troublesome hamstring

* Manchester United are weighing up whether to put Paul Pogba in for surgery
* The midfielder has been absent after struggling with a hamstring injury
* Surgeon Sakari Orava has compared Pogba's injury with Ousmane Dembele's


Manchester United are weighing up whether to send Paul Pogba under the knife in order to put an end to his troublesome hamstring injury.

The midfielder has been out of action for the Red Devils since limping out of their Champions League clash with Basle on September 12.

Pogba has been struggling with a hamstring issue, and the club must now make the call on whether to allow the player to recover naturally or head to the operating theatre in order to speed up the process.

Surgeon Sakari Orava, who has monitored Pogba before and has also been helping oversee the recovery of Barcelona starlet Ousmane Dembele, has shone further light on the situation.

'His wound is a bit different from Dembele because he can cure without surgery,' Orava stated, as reported by French publication L'Equipe.


Manchester United will make a decision on whether to put Paul Pogba in for hamstring surgery

The surgeon, however, has suggested that an operation may be more beneficial for Pogba in this instance, and may help him return stronger to the Old Trafford fold.

'A decision will be made next week,' Orava added.

United face a tough run of fixtures without their £89million superstar, beginning with a long-haul trip to Russia this week to face CSKA Moscow in the Champions League.

The Red Devils will then return to Premier League action against Crystal Palace, before travelling to Anfield to lock horns with bitter rivals Liverpool.

An official announcement from the club is expected in due course regarding the extent of Pogba's lay-off and the action taken by medical staff.

Lukaku Cedera Engkel
Yanu Arifin - detikSport

Brussels - Kabar tak sedap mendatangi Manchester United. Striker andalannya, Romelu Lukaku, cedera saat sesi latihan Timnas Belgia. Apakah harus absen lama?

Lukaku kini sedang berada bersama Timnas Belgia untuk laga Kualifikasi Piala Dunia 2018. Pada sesi latihan, Senin (2/10/2017) waktu setempat kemarin, pemain 24 tahun itu mengalami masalah pada engeklnya.

Alhasil, Lukaku pun harus menjalani latihan terpisah. Untungnya cedera Lukaku itu tidak parah yang harus membuatnya absen untuk waktu lama.

Masalah itu diyakini didapat Lukaku saat membela Manchester United melawan Crystal Palace akhir pekan lalu. Di laga itu, ia mencetak satu gol untuk mengantar The Red Devils menang 4-0.

"@RomeluLukaku9 mengalami cedera IRM (pergelangan kaki) siang ini. Tidak ada yang retak, program latihan individu akan dijalani," demikian pernyataan resmi timnas Belgia.

Lukaku tampil bersinar musim ini, dengan sudah mencetak 11 gol dari 10 laga. Hal itu membuat manajer MU Jose Mourinho belum mengistirahatkannya sama sekali.

Meski cederanya tidak parah parah, belum diketahui apakah Lukaku bisa bermain menghadapi Bosnia-Herzegovina pada Sabtu (7/10/2017) dan Siprus, Rabu (11/10).

Belgia sendiri sudah memastikan lolos ke putaran final Piala Dunia 2018. Mereka memuncaki klasemen Grup H dengan poin 22 dari delapan pertandingan, hasil tujuh kali menang dan sekali imbang.
